If you&#8217;ve never seen 1977&#8217;s <em><strong>Suspiria</strong></em> and 1980&#8217;s <em><strong>Inferno</strong></em>, you&#8217;re missing two of the most intense horror movies of all time. Acclaimed Italian director <strong>Dario Argento</strong> created the two films back to back, hoping that they would be the first two installments in his <strong>Three Mothers</strong> trilogy that revolves around a trio of evil witches.</p>
<p>Well, after 28 years, the final film in the trilogy is finally hitting theatres. <em><strong>Mother Of Tears</strong></em>, which stars the director&#8217;s daughter <strong>Asia Argento</strong> (you might remember her from <em>XXX</em>), follows the story of an American student in Rome who uncovers an ancient urn that unleashes the power of a witch upon the city. Argento&#8217;s movies are known for their stylish use of color and sound, along with a tendency towards amble gore and sex.
